Feature/add create object service (#476)
Added BACnet CreateObject and DeleteObject services * refactored codec for BACnetPropertyValue into bacapp module * added unit tests for BACnetPropertyValue * refactored COV and Events to use BACnetPropertyValue codec API * added unit tests for COV * added overrun safe decoders for tag numbers and boolean context * added unit tests and codecs for CreateObject and DeleteObject services * added APDU service handers and senders for CreateObject and DeleteObject services * added command line apps bacco and bacdo for CreateObject and DeleteObject services * added CreateObject and DeleteObject service handling in example server app and device object * added new BACnetRejectReason, Error Class, and BACnetAbortReason enumerations and conversions --------- Co-authored-by: Steve Karg <skarg@users.sourceforge.net>
